Biden Celebrates Climate Legacy with Historic Amazon Rainforest Visit, Promises Environmental and Economic Progress

admin
SHARE

In a significant visit to the Amazon rainforest, US President Joe Biden took to the skies on Sunday, flying over the vibrant ecosystem as part of his ongoing South American tour. His stop in Manaus, Brazil, underscored his administration’s commitment to addressing climate change, promoting sustainability, and working alongside Indigenous leaders to safeguard the environment.

While in Brazil, Biden engaged in discussions with Indigenous groups and environmental advocates about the importance of preserving the Amazon, which is crucial for global climate regulation. He also signed a proclamation designating November 17 as International Conservation Day, reinforcing his dedication to environmental protection.

In a speech following his visit, Biden highlighted the notion that the United States can successfully balance economic growth with environmental stewardship. “Folks, we don’t have to choose between an environment and the economy. We can do both,” Biden asserted, reflecting his administration’s vision of a green economy that generates jobs while lowering carbon emissions.

A Strong Stand Against Climate Change in the Face of Challenges

Biden’s visit occurs at a critical juncture as he approaches the final stages of his presidency, coinciding with Donald Trump, his political rival, preparing for a potential return to the White House. Despite the changing political landscape, Biden expressed confidence that his climate agenda would persist, emphasizing his administration’s commitment to long-term environmental sustainability.

The Amazon, essential for global biodiversity and functioning as the Earth’s lungs by absorbing significant amounts of carbon dioxide, has been a focal point of Biden’s climate strategy. Under his leadership, the US has made considerable strides in rejoining the Paris Agreement and enhancing global collaboration on climate change. Biden’s visit to the Amazon symbolized the US’s renewed dedication to global environmental leadership.
